In this eye opening interview, Professor, Venkat Iyer, Ph.D., CPA, from the University of North Carolina at Greensboro discusses his recent research on job satisfaction in the Internal Audit profession. Venkat specializes in organizational and behavioral issues in audit firms and the internal audit profession. He began his career at UNCG’s Bryant School of Business and Economics in 1999 as an Assistant Professor. He earned his Ph.D. in Business Administration from the J.M. School of Accounting at the University of Georgia, in Athens Georgia. He is a CPA and has many notable publications and honors, including the Teaching Excellence Award from the Bryan School at UNCG in 2005.
